Nscale, the buzzy U.K.-based AI data center startup, has appointed former OpenAI, Meta and Instacart executive Fidji Simo to its board.
Simo joins high-profile tech executives Sheryl Sandberg, Susan Decker and Nick Clegg on Nscale’s board ahead of the startup’s anticipated IPO this fall.
Formerly CEO of AGI Deployment at OpenAI, essentially the No. 2 executive at the AI lab, Simo left the company in July citing health reasons. She still advises the company on a part-time basis. Before OpenAI, Simo was chair and CEO of Instacart, where she led the company through its 2023 IPO. She also spent more than a decade at Meta, including as head of the Facebook app. Simo also sits on Shopify’s board.
